Abstract: Schmitt trigger is designed using the single second generation Current Controlled Conveyor. The proposed configuration utilizes single CCCII and only two externally connected resistors and is able to produce dual output square wave signal. The topology has the benefit of having a simple circuit, offering a large bandwidth and improved slew rate. PSPICE simulator using OrCad 16.3 version, 0.35 µm CMOS technology is used to verify the design, hysteresis is determined and compared with the existing methods available in the literature. The proposed configuration is tested using the experimental setup involving CFOA (AD844AN) and OTA (LM13700). The results have been found satisfactory in both simulation and experimental aspect. Montecarlo analysis and worstcase analysis are determined to prove the circuit efficiency in terms of critical parameters such as resistance with a tolerance of 5%. The hysteresis is also determined, that can reduce the effect of noise, able to produce exact square wave at the output. Schmitt trigger circuits find the applications in the field of Biomedical applications, analog signal processing, communication systems, waveform generators, pulse width modulators, multivibrators, flip-flops and in many other amplifier circuits. The basic application of Schmitt trigger is a square wave generator. The proposed topology is the best suited for monolithic IC fabrication.

Abstract: A simple and convenient method for the synthesis of 2,5-disubstituted 1,3,4-oxadiazoles has been developed. Structurally divergent symmetrical and unsymmetrical 2,5-disubstituted 1,3,4-oxadiazoles can be obtained in moderate to high yields via NaOCl-mediated oxidative cyclization of N-acylhydrazones, generated in situ from aliphatic and aromatic hydrazides and aldehydes.

Abstract: Interleukin-4 is a signature cytokine of T-helper type 2 (Th2) cells that play a major role in shaping immune responses. Its role in highly relevant animal model of tuberculosis (TB) like guinea pig has not been studied till date. In the current study, the guinea pig IL-4 gene was cloned and expressed using a prokaryotic expression vector (pET30 a(+)). This approach yielded a recombinant protein of 19 kDa as confirmed by mass spectrometry analysis and named as recombinant guinea pig (rgp)IL-4 protein. The authenticity of the expression of rgpIL-4 protein was further verified through polyclonal anti-IL4 antiserum raised in rabbits that showed specific and strong binding with the recombinant protein. The biological activity of the rgpIL-4 was ascertained in RAW264.7 cells where LPS-treated nitric oxide (NO) production was found to be suppressed in the presence of this protein. The three-dimensional structure of guinea pig IL-4 was predicted by utilizing the template structure of human interleukin-4, which shared a sequence homology of 58%. The homology modeling result showed clear resemblance of guinea pig IL-4 structure with the human IL-4. Taken together, our study indicates that the newly expressed, biologically active rgpIL-4 protein could provide deeper understanding of the immune responses in guinea pig to different infectious diseases like TB and non-infectious ones.

Abstract: The voltage ripple is reduced by using conventional proportional integral (PI) controllers require additional filter, and also occurs tuning problem with these controllers. Due to the operating point changes in conventional PI controllers get a nonlinearity output. To overcome above problem, this paper presents Type-2 Neuro fuzzy system (T2NFS) to reduce the voltage ripple in the induction motor by using indirect vector control method. The T2NFS controller performance as compared with conventional proportional integral (PI) controller, voltage ripple reduced in the induction motor without any additional filter and tuning problem is eliminated. In this, the current reference values and original values of current are fed to the T2NFS based controllers and the controller is trained based on the obtained values. The performance of induction motor with indirect vector control method by using T2NFS controllers has been simulated at different operation regions and compared results with PI controllers. The results are experimentally verified with d-space 1104.
